The story behind one of the greatest conservation victories in the Mediterranean, which ensured the protection of one of the most important "maternity wards" of the loggerhead turtle in the region.
The film takes us to a 550 meters long beach that has become a symbol for the protection of sea turtles, and the wildlife of the Mediterranean.
Sekania in the island of Zakynthos in Greece is the nesting site with the highest density of loggerhead turtle nests in the world, as in the last 30 years or so, this small strip of coast has hosted more than 1,500,000 eggs. The area is 'the heart' of the National Marine Park of Zakynthos.
The documentary "Sekania: A beach for the sea turtle Caretta caretta" is directed by Vicky Markolefa and Bastian Fischer - Mind The Bump Productions and produced by WWF.
